How Apetox Syrup works:

Apetox Syrup is an antihistamine that counteracts inflammatory chemical messengers, alleviating symptoms like congestion, itching, and other allergic responses. Its action also promotes appetite stimulation, potentially linked to increased energy consumption and growth hormone release.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Concurrent use of Apetox Syrup and alcohol may result in significant sleepiness.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on Apetox Syrup use in pregnancy is absent. Seek medical advice from your physician.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on Apetox Syrup's compatibility with breastfeeding is l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ving ability may be impaired by Apetox Syrup's side effects. Elderly individuals may experience dizziness, drowsiness, and low blood pressure after taking Apetox Syrup, potentially impacting their capacity to drive.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

For individuals with advanced kidney impairment, Apetox Syrup requires careful administration. Dosage modification of Apetox Syrup might be necessary. Physician consultation is recommended.

LiverLiverC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data regarding Apetox Syrup's use in individuals with hepatic impairment is scarce.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Apetox Syrup :

Should you forget a dose of Apetox Syrup, administer it at your earliest convenience. If, however, your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Never take a double dose.
